    Jamaal Williams: biography

    Jamaal Williams is a professional American football running back who played for the Green Bay Packers from 2017 to 2020, and then joined the Detroit Lions in 2021.

    Childhood and youth

    Jamaal Williams was born on April 3, 1995, in Rialto, California, and spent his childhood in the city. Growing up, Williams showed a strong interest in sports, particularly in football. He attended Summit High School in Fontana, California, where he played football as a running back and linebacker.

    Williams had an impressive high school career, rushing for 3,595 yards and 46 touchdowns, and earning All-League and All-CIF honors in his senior year. He also excelled in track and field, where he participated in the 100-meter dash, 200-meter dash, and long jump events.

    After graduating from high school in 2013, Williams enrolled at Brigham Young University (BYU), where he continued to play football as a running back. During his time at BYU, Williams became one of the team's most productive players, rushing for 3,901 yards and 35 touchdowns, and earning All-Independent honors in his senior year.

    Football career

    Jamaal Williams' football career started at Brigham Young University (BYU), where he played as a running back for four years from 2013 to 2016. During his college career, Williams established himself as one of the most productive and versatile players in the nation, earning All-Independent honors in his senior year.

    Williams' career highlights at BYU include rushing for over 1,200 yards and 5 touchdowns in his junior year, and setting a school record for most rushing yards in a single game with 286 yards against Toledo in his senior year. He also showed his versatility as a pass-catching running back, catching 60 passes for 567 yards and 1 touchdown over his college career.

    Williams was selected by the Green Bay Packers in the fourth round of the 2017 NFL Draft, and he quickly became a key player for the team, especially as a pass-catching running back. During his four seasons in Green Bay, Williams played in 60 games, rushing for 1,985 yards and 10 touchdowns, and catching 122 passes for 961 yards and 8 touchdowns.

    Williams' best season with the Packers was arguably in 2019, when he rushed for 460 yards and 1 touchdown, caught 39 passes for 253 yards and 5 touchdowns, and had a career-high 107 carries. He also played a key role in the team's playoff run that year, rushing for 71 yards and catching 4 passes for 35 yards in the team's divisional round loss to the San Francisco 49ers.

    In 2021, Williams signed a two-year contract with the Detroit Lions, where he is expected to play a significant role in the team's running game. In his first season with the Lions, Williams rushed for 516 yards and 2 touchdowns, caught 47 passes for 349 yards and 2 touchdowns, and played in all 17 games.

    Personal life

    It’s not known if Jamaal Williams is dating someone or not. There is information that he has a daughter called Kalea.

    Off the field, Jamaal Williams is known for his outgoing and fun-loving personality. He is active on social media, where he often shares insights into his personal life, including his interests in music and fashion.

    Williams is also passionate about giving back to his community. He has participated in several charity events and community service activities, including volunteering at local schools and food banks.
